Greenbay Road is in London and in Greenwich district. SE7 8PS is located in the Charlton Hornfair elect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Eltham.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Greenbay Road was 92.5 per 1,000 residents, which is 10.6% higher than the Charlton Hornfair average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.
Greenbay Road has the 30th highest crime rate of 66 local areas in Charlton Hornfair and the 381st highest crime rate of 771 local areas in Greenwich .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 52.0 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-33.3%.
